Cipla Foundation, Tata IISc Med School to set up Centre for Pulmonary Medicine

Bengaluru: Cipla Foundation Wednesday announced a partnership with the Indian Institute of Science (IISc) to set up the Cipla Foundation Centre for Pulmonary Medicine at the Tata IISc Medical School.
